The Hilton Garden Inn Lecce offers a well-rounded and generally positive experience for travelers, especially those prioritizing convenience, cleanliness and amenities during their stay. Located about a 15-20 minute walk from Lecce's historic center, the hotel strikes a balance between accessibility and tranquility, though some guests find the walk to be a bit long, especially in hot weather. The convenience of on-site parking is a significant advantage, particularly for those traveling by car or on business.
Guests often praise the hotel's facilities, which include a well-equipped gym, an elegant terrace pool and an impressive spa. The rooftop pool, in particular, stands out for its panoramic views and relaxing ambiance. Reviews frequently highlight the exceptional cleanliness of the hotel with rooms described as spacious, comfortable and well-maintained. The staff's friendliness and professionalism also contribute significantly to the positive atmosphere with particular commendation for team members like the Spa manager Monica.
The breakfast at Hilton Garden Inn Lecce receives mixed but mostly positive feedback. The buffet is appreciated for its variety and quality, featuring numerous local and international options. However, some guests point out organizational issues and feel the price of €15 per person is steep for the offered service. On the other hand, while the on-site dining for lunch and dinner has satisfied some guests with its quality and professional service, others report limited menu options and high prices.
Comfortable beds and consistent cleanliness in the rooms are frequently highlighted as key strengths of the hotel, ensuring a restful stay for guests. However, a few noted minor issues like outdated furniture, room temperature problems and occasional noise disturbances. The staff's courtesy and responsiveness, particularly at reception and in the spa, further enhance the guest experience.
One significant area needing improvement is the hotel's Wi-Fi, which many reviews describe as unstable and inconvenient due to frequent expirations and weak signal strengths.
In summary, the Hilton Garden Inn Lecce offers a comfortable, clean and well-equipped environment with a balanced location and friendly staff, though it has room for improvement in areas such as Wi-Fi connectivity and some aspects of its dining services.
